UK, United Kingdom | Posted on 06/04/2024 A multinational technology corporation is looking for a commercially driven candidate who thrives in fast-paced environments to be the single-threaded owner of Blink’s regional product marketing.
This role involves building out the vision and driving operational improvements both on the e-commerce platforms and through the Retail Channel Partners.
This high-visibility position offers regular exposure to senior leadership and drives the positioning of Blink products.
Requirements BS in Marketing, Business, or a related field.
Experience with Excel or Tableau (data manipulation, macros, charts, and pivot tables).
Experience building, executing, and scaling cross-functional marketing programs.
Experience using data and metrics to measure impact and determine improvements.
Experience presenting metrics and progress to goal to senior leadership.
Experience with customer segmentation, profiling, targeting and market search.
Experience leading go-to-market for consumer software or hardware product launches.
Excellent communication, collaboration, and analytical skills.
Familiarity with e-commerce platforms and retail channel management.
